"5" is already a decimal number. You could also write it as "5.0". A decimal is a whole number in the decimal (base-10) number system or a proper fraction whose denominator is a power of 10. Decimal numbers are written by convention with the whole-number part to the left of a "decimal point" (.) and the fractional part to the right. Either or both the whole or fractional part may be zero (0).
